Representing the MIT brand
When you post to third-party social media outlets on behalf of MIT, you are representing the MIT brand. Here are some simple guidelines to help you put your best foot forward. If you have specific questions on branding, please contact Communication Production Services (CPS).
- Always begin with MIT when creating a name for your Facebook page, Twitter page or blog: MIT School of Science, MIT Media Lab.
- Use of the MIT logo is reserved for MIT’s institutional pages, such as the MIT News Office.
- Departments, schools or labs should use their official logo or an iconic photo or image that is representative of the organization.
- Follow all MIT identity guidelines. If you have questions, contact CPS.
- Follow MIT's policies and procedures regarding copyright, privacy and sharing of information.
